What Services Are Included in Upholstery Cleaning?

A professional upholstery cleaning service usually offers more than just surface-level vacuuming. Depending on your furniture type and the provider you choose, services may include:

1. Fabric Inspection

Before any cleaning begins, technicians inspect the upholstery to identify the fabric type and any specific care requirements.

2. Vacuuming and Dust Removal

High-powered vacuuming removes loose dust, pet hair, and debris from the surface and deep crevices.

3. Stain Pre-Treatment

Spots and stains are treated with fabric-safe solutions designed to break down substances like wine, coffee, ink, or grease.

4. Deep Cleaning Methods

Professionals may use steam cleaning (hot water extraction), dry cleaning, or foam cleaning based on your upholstery’s fabric.

5. Deodorizing and Sanitizing

To eliminate lingering odors and bacteria, deodorizing agents and antimicrobial sprays are often applied.

6. Fabric Protection (Optional)

Some companies offer protective coatings to guard against future spills and wear.


Popular Methods Used in Upholstery Cleaning

Different fabric types require different cleaning techniques. Below are some of the most commonly used methods in New York upholstery services:

• Steam Cleaning

Best for durable, synthetic fabrics. Hot water and cleaning solutions are injected into the fabric and then extracted, removing dirt and bacteria.

• Dry Cleaning

Used for delicate fabrics that can’t be exposed to moisture. A solvent-based process removes stains and refreshes fabric without soaking.

• Encapsulation (Foam Cleaning)

A low-moisture method where foam encapsulates dirt particles, which are then vacuumed away.

• Hand Cleaning

Used on antique or luxury upholstery, this involves gentle manual scrubbing with soft brushes and eco-friendly products.

How Often Should You Get Upholstery Cleaned?

There’s no one-size-fits-all answer, but here are some general guidelines:

  • Every 6 to 12 months: For typical households

  • Every 3 to 6 months: If you have pets, children, or allergies

  • Immediately: After visible stains or accidental spills

Routine cleaning extends the life of your furniture, keeps it looking vibrant, and helps improve indoor air quality.

Cost of Upholstery Cleaning in NYC

Prices can vary based on the service provider, type of upholstery, and the size of the furniture. Here’s a general idea:

  • Armchairs: $40–$75

  • Loveseats: $60–$100

  • Sofas: $90–$150+

  • Sectionals: $150–$300+

Additional costs may apply for deep stains, delicate fabrics, or protective treatments.


Tips to Keep Upholstery Clean Between Professional Services

Want to make your professional clean last longer? Try these simple maintenance tips:

  • Vacuum furniture weekly to remove dust and pet hair.

  • Spot clean spills immediately to prevent permanent staining.

  • Rotate cushions to promote even wear.

  • Use washable slipcovers on high-use items.

  • Keep pets groomed and use throws or blankets in their favorite spots.
